The olive fruit harvest is in progress throughout the country.
Although there was a good start this year, the market did not seem to give high prices. However, many growers claim that there are significant problems in cultivation costs and in the fact that olive oil does not give them the necessary income to support their families.
There seems to be reduced outcome, but good quality in the district of Messinia (province of Peloponnese). Harvesting takes place, but there is lack of land workers. As Mr. Giannis Zontanos, head of Agricultural Cooperative of Messina states in AgroTypos, at this time there is reduced commercial activity by Italians, while prices for good quality olive oil range between 2.40 - 2.70 euros per kilo.
